This print titled "The Squirrel" by John Hassall takes us on a nostalgic journey through the enchanting world of childhood adventures. Set against a backdrop of lush green forestry, a young boy stands in awe as he encounters several animals amidst towering trees. The vibrant colors and intricate details bring to life the beauty of nature's bounty. In this idyllic scene, the mischievous squirrel becomes the center of attention, its agile movements captured with precision. As it scampers along branches, gathering firwood for kindling, we are reminded of the harmony between humans and wildlife in rural landscapes. The print is part of a larger collection called "Through the Wood, A Picture Book" illustrated by Hassall and written by Harold Avery in 1907. It serves as an educational tool for children to explore botany and natural history while igniting their imagination.
